GAC releases 2020 schedules

-

RUSSELLVIL­LE On Friday, The Great American Conference announced its Council of Presidents approved changes to the league's upcoming football and basketball schedules, as well as alteration­s to the conference's championsh­ip formats.

The 2020 football season now consists of the GAC's twelve member schools playing a ten-game conference schedule that can begin on Thursday, September 10. The tengame slate correspond­s with changes to maximum playing seasons passed by the NCAA Division II Presidents Council earlier this month.

For the 2020-21 basketball season, the league will still compete in a double round-robin format, but will eliminate non-conference contests. That season opens on Friday, November 13. The 22-game season represents the maximum playable contests set forth by the NCAA.

"The Great American Conference athletic administra­tors, Commission­er Will Prewitt and Council of Presidents have worked very diligently to modify sports schedules to comply with new NCAA Division II guidelines," said Northweste­rn Oklahoma State President and GAC Council of Presidents Chairwoman Dr. Janet Cunningham. "I believe we have struck a good balance of cost efficienci­es and student-athlete safety while also preserving the student-athlete experience."

With regards to the 14 conference championsh­ips the GAC contests, the number of competing teams will remain the same as in years past. However, a series of championsh­ips will see a reduction in length and multiple events will move to campus locations. The volleyball, basketball, golf, women's tennis, baseball, and softball championsh­ips see oneday reductions in their formats.

"I'm appreciati­ve our leadership identified ways to retain championsh­ip experience­s for as many teams and individual­s as possible," Prewitt said.
